For the seventh year in a row, the Winter Garden of the P.Hertsen MORI, has hosted concerts and creative evenings of the famous performers and creative groups. Soloists of the Helikon Opera, journalist and writer Alexei Simonov – son of Konstantin Simonov, son of Vladimir Vysotsky – Nikita Vysotsky, People’s Artist of Russia Sergey Nikonenko, young musicians of the Vladimir Spivakov Academy and many others have visited the Winter Garden.
This time Felix Tsarikati, Honored Artist of Russia, came to visit the patients and staff of the Institute on the eve of Defender of the Fatherland Day. Unusually heartfelt and well-known to the whole country songs from the repertoire of Mark Bernes performed by him filled the hall with warmth and love for the country, for the song, for the Motherland.
It is not the first time Felix Viktorovich comes to us to support doctors, medical staff, patients, who invariably respond to him with love. Songs of the war years are a special page in the artist’s creativity. He has released more than ten albums, among which the album “Songs of the War Years” takes a special place.
Always trim, always “in voice”, the artist is proud of the fact that his service to art has been recognized with awards from many republics of our country: Kabardino-Balkaria, Karachay-Cherkessia, South Ossetia and North Ossetia Alania, Ingushetia. His songs organically combine love for romances, classical art, patriotic and folk songs, which he sings from the heart.
